Environmental issues can have a significant impact on farmers’ profits and productivity. Soil quality, water quality, climate, and terrain can all affect the success of a farm. Understanding the potential impact of these issues can help farmers plan and prepare for a successful growing season.<\/p>\n
What were the consequences of agriculture for humans? <\/h2>\n
When early humans began farming, they were able to produce enough food that they no longer had to migrate to their food source. This meant they could build permanent structures, and develop villages, towns, and eventually even cities. Closely connected to the rise of settled societies was an increase in population.<\/p>\n

The way we grow and raise our food has changed dramatically over the years and evolved into what we now call “industrial agriculture.” This system is very resource intensive, and as demand for food has increased, so has the negative impact on the environment.<\/p>\n
Industrial agriculture often involves monoculture crops, or the planting of a single crop over a large area. This can lead to soil erosion from the lack of diverse plant life to hold the soil in place. The use of heavy machinery can also compact the soil, making it harder for plants to grow.<\/p>\n
Fertilizers and pesticides are commonly used in industrial agriculture in order to boost crop yields. However, these chemicals can run off into waterways, causing pollution. Additionally, the overuse of antibiotics in livestock can lead to the development of antibiotic-resistant bacteria.<\/p>\n
As the population continues to grow, the demand for food will only increase. It’s important that we find ways to produce food that have less of an impact on the environment.<\/p>\n
